Jan-Pro Master Franchise Opportunity
As a Regional, Master franchisee, one of the main responsibilities is to develop your region by selling and supporting Unit Franchises within their exclusive territory during normal business hours. The Master Franchise office then provides guaranteed customers, accounting, training, field support and marketing assistance. The Unit Franchisees provide the cleaning services to the customers.

The Company
- JAN-PRO Franchising International, Inc. was founded in 1991.
- Currently JAN-PRO has over 90 Master Franchise offices in the US, Canada, GB and Ireland with over 7000 Unit Franchisees.

The Jan-Pro Difference
- Our competitive advantage: it comes from quality and consistency because the people doing the cleaning – the Unit Franchisees – are committed financially in the results. How? Contracts are granted by the Master to Unit franchisees but they may lose their investment if they lose their accounts for unsatisfactory reasons.

The Franchise Fee and Training
- Our Franchise Fee is based on up to $20,000 for every 100,000 in population.
- A portion of the franchise fee may be financed through us.
- We also require $75,000 to $100,000 working capital.
- Minimum liquidity - $200,000 (in hand or third party financing)
- An ideal location is a metropolitan area of 400,000 or more in population.
- Initial Training: two weeks in USA.
- Start up support: one week on site at the opening.
- Annual Meeting/Additional specific trainings provided all year long in USA or Canada (Travel expenses at the Master’s charge)
